Output 3e70ee6827672c98478c48632302c19d24cb9450f650b2d8ef0f58961663df90:1

value
661297782
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d86861b60266f5c36a461d4ab9efbc13203f18d7 OP_EQUALVERIFY OP_CHECKSIG
address
1LjG117Lw7JWRf9PaYZu19SHnP6K4Wi933
transaction
3e70ee6827672c98478c48632302c19d24cb9450f650b2d8ef0f58961663df90
confirmations
591046
spent
true